Soldiers Home in Chelsea

Established in 1882, the Soldiers Home in Chelsea serves as a sanctuary for veterans who have bravely served the nation. Situated on a picturesque campus spanning over 30 acres, the facility provides a serene and supportive environment for retired military personnel. Encircled by lush greenery and historic buildings, the Soldiers Home offers a peaceful retreat for those who have dedicated their lives to serving the country.

The Soldiers Home in Chelsea embraces a holistic approach to care, aiming to enhance the physical, mental, and emotional well-being of its residents. With a range of programs and services tailored to meet the unique needs of veterans, the facility fosters a sense of community and camaraderie among its inhabitants. From engaging recreational activities to specialized healthcare services, the Soldiers Home is dedicated to honoring and supporting the men and women who have selflessly served in the armed forces.

Winnisimmet Park

Winnisimmet Park, located in Chelsea, Massachusetts, is a picturesque green space that offers a peaceful retreat from the hustle and bustle of city life. The park boasts lush greenery, shady trees, and well-maintained walking paths, making it the perfect spot for a leisurely stroll or a relaxing picnic with friends and family.

Visitors to Winnisimmet Park can also enjoy amenities such as playgrounds for children, basketball courts for sports enthusiasts, and open spaces for outdoor gatherings. The park is a popular spot for locals and tourists alike, offering a tranquil escape in the heart of Chelsea. Whether you’re looking to unwind surrounded by nature or engage in some outdoor activities, Winnisimmet Park has something for everyone to enjoy.
